HPC集群性能优化策略与实践指南 高性能计算(HPC)集群在科学研究、工程模拟、大数据分析等领域发挥着越来越重要的作用。然而,随着问题规模的不断扩大和计算需求的不断增加,HPC集群的性能优化变得尤为关键。本文将从硬件架构优化、并行计算优化、存储系统优化等方面出发,探讨HPC集群性能优化的策略与实践指南。 在HPC集群的硬件架构优化方面,首先需要考虑的是选择合适的处理器架构和数量。对于不同类型的科学计算和工程模拟应用,需要针对性地选择CPU或加速器,以达到最佳的性能和能效比。此外,优化内存带宽、网络带宽、以及节点互连结构,也是提升HPC集群性能的重要手段。 在并行计算优化方面,必须充分利用集群中每个节点的计算资源。通过合理划分任务和优化通讯设计,可以实现任务的并行执行,提高计算效率。同时,选择合适的编译器和优化编译参数,对代码进行并行化和向量化优化,也是提升性能的有效途径。 存储系统在HPC集群中占据着重要地位,因为大规模科学计算和工程模拟产生的数据量巨大。因此,如何优化存储系统的读写效率成为HPC集群性能优化的重要课题。采用高速存储设备、优化文件系统设计、合理划分数据存储策略等手段都可以有效提升数据读写性能。 此外,定期进行系统性能监测与分析也是HPC集群性能优化的重要环节。通过监测节点负载、网络流量、存储I/O等指标,可以及时发现并解决集群中的性能瓶颈问题,从而保证集群的稳定运行和高效工作。 综上所述,HPC集群性能优化需要综合考虑硬件架构、并行计算、存储系统和系统监测等多个方面的因素。只有在这些方面都做到充分优化和协调配合的情况下,HPC集群才能发挥最大的性能潜力,为科学研究和工程计算提供有力支持。 |
说点什么...